Environmental Renewal and Protection Techniques
Ecological restoration aims to rejuvenate damaged ecosystems, returning them to a healthier and more functional state. This process involves various strategies, such as habitat recreation, species transplantation, and the control of invasive species. Conservation strategies focus on preserving existing ecosystems and biodiversity through methods like protected zones, sustainable resource management, and public awareness initiatives. By combining restoration and conservation efforts, we can effectively mitigate the impacts of human activity and promote a more resilient future.

Combating Climate Change: A Plan for Mitigation and Adaptation
Effective strategies to combat climate change require a comprehensive system that encompasses both mitigation and adaptation. Mitigation efforts focus on reducing greenhouse gas emissions through transitioning to renewable energy sources, improving energy efficiency, and implementing sustainable land use practices. In parallel, adaptation measures aim to bolster resilience to the inevitable impacts of climate change that are already being witnessed. This may involve allocating resources infrastructure upgrades, developing early warning systems for extreme weather events, and promoting adaptive agricultural practices. A successful climate action strategy must integrate these mitigation and adaptation approaches to create a more sustainable and resilient future.
